Atlanta Falcons quarterback Matt Ryan and wide receiver Julio Jones had two of the top 25 selling NFL jerseys in May.

Jones, entering his seventh season as a Falcon, landed at the No. 9 spot and was also the best selling jersey in the state of Georgia.

Ryan, the League’s reigning MVP Ryan, ranked No. 19 on May’s top selling jerseys list.

The top selling jersey in May belonged to Oakland Raiders running back Marshawn Lynch. New England Patriots quarterback Tom Brady was the top quarterback on the list at the No. 2 spot.

Carolina Panthers quarterback Cam Newton, from College Park, Ga., had the 23rd most popular jersey sold in May.
